Heron Island, classified a National Park and Marine Park, is a coral cay formed as part of the Great Barrier Reef some 8,500 years ago. Heron’s pristine waters support coral reefs of great beauty and diversity. More than 70% of all the Barrier Reef’s coral species can be found in the area. Heron Island is a diverse paradise and there are more than 30 dive sites around the island - you may prefer to snorkel or view the reef through the large picture windows of the semi-submersible boat.
